Lei Jun: Xiaomi is building the next generation fully automated factory

In yesterday’s Xiaomi Mi 10 press conference “Cloud Interview”, Xiaomi’s CEO, Lei Jun, said that the first phase of Xiaomi’s mobile phone experimental factory in Yizhuang is complete, and “the degree of automation is very high.” Lei Jun also stated that Xiaomi is already building the next generation of completely unmanned automated factories.

Xiaomi Chairman Lei Jun said, “We even set up an IoT platform department two years ago to specifically address the interconnectivity of IoT. Recently everyone also knows that our experimental factory is ready for opening. However, the epidemic situation is slowing things down but our experimental project is highly automatic. The first phase in Yizhuang is complete, we are building the next-generation fully automated factory. “

According to reports, the factory will use technologies such as automated production lines and 5G network to greatly increase production efficiency. It will automatically produce 60 smartphones per minute, which is more than 60% higher than traditional factories. However, an official statement from Xiaomi says that the Yizhuang plant is a trial plant. This means that it is not yet ready for the mass production of mobile phones.

With respect to the Xiaomi Mi 10, Lei Jun said that the epidemic situation did not affect its production capacity. However, the production factory is currently not open. This means that the Xiaomi Mi 10 series may run out of stock in a week or two.
